Karishk pushed the man roughly forward. "I see that," she said harshly. "Don't try to twist your hands out of that rope or soon you won't have any hands."

She wouldn't really chop off the man's hands, but he believed it, he immediately stilled his hands.  The man was a vassal of a man named Thomas Heinfield.  The vassal had stolen money and other things from the town granary and then run off with it.  One of Heinfield's men had hired Karishk to capture the vassal and return him to the place where Heinfield lived.

The mission had been fairly easy, the vassal hadn't gotten far, he was not, by any means, an experienced criminal.  He was just a greedy man who wanted more money and thought he could easily get some.  It had taken Karihk only three days to get the man and bring him back, and now she had entered the gate to Heinfield's mansion and was walking up to the door.  She knocked, and a moment later the door was opened by the butler.

He nodded to Karishk when she identified herself and then called to another man, Robert.  Robert came and took the vassal away, for trial, to jail, Karishk didn't really care, she just wanted her pay, and she told the butler that.

"Come with me," he said, and led her into the house.  Karishk followed him down corridors, through doors, up stairs, and around corners until they came to a polished wooden door.  "Wait here," the butler said, and he stepped inside the room.

Karishk assumed that that was where this Thomas Heinfield was, but she wished this process woudl go a little quicker.  She just wanted her money so she could get out of here.  it wasn't as though she was uncomfortable in the mansion, it was just that she was bored, and she didn't really like rich people.  Many were born into riches, and didn't have to any work for it.  She had done her job, couldn't they just give her a pile of coins and she would go on her way?  Unless they had lied to her and weren't really going to pay her at all. 

Karishk's hand immediately shot to her sword hilt.  That sort of thing had happened before.  She was hired, did the job, and then was cheated, often those who hired her tried to kill her afterwards to stop her from causing any trouble.  Obviously, no one had managed to kill her yet, and she didn't want to fight her way out of this job.  Her pockets were empty and she really needed all of the money she could get.

She looked up and stiffened as the expensive polished door opened.
